From 4 hours to under 5 minutes

Internet lead response time

Studies show that responding to an automotive internet lead within 5 minutes increases contact rate by 100x compared to a 30-minute response. The agent responds immediately, 24/7, qualifying interest before a human sales rep engages.

Improved by 15–20%

Service department capacity utilization

Optimized appointment scheduling that accounts for technician specialization, job duration, and parts availability fills scheduling gaps that manual booking leaves open, increasing billed hours per technician per day.

Reduced by 60%

Warranty claim processing time

Manual warranty submissions involve documentation collection, eligibility lookup, and portal entry that takes 45–90 minutes per claim. The agent completes this in under 20 minutes with lower error rates, accelerating OEM reimbursement.

Improved from 78% to 95%

Parts availability for scheduled appointments

Proactive parts ordering triggered by the agent's appointment-aware inventory analysis eliminates the common scenario where a vehicle is on the lift but the required part is on a two-day backorder — protecting CSI scores and service department throughput.

FAQ

Common Questions About AI Agents For Automotive

What automotive business processes benefit most from AI agents?+

The highest-impact processes are those combining high volume with defined decision rules: lead response and qualification, service appointment scheduling, inventory pricing, parts ordering, and warranty claim submission. These are time-sensitive, repetitive, and directly tied to revenue — making them ideal candidates for autonomous agent operation.

How does an AI agent integrate with a dealership management system (DMS)?+

Remote Lama builds connectors to major DMS platforms including CDK Global, Reynolds & Reynolds, DealerSocket, and Tekion using their API layers or certified integration frameworks. The agent reads inventory, customer, and RO data from the DMS and writes approved actions — appointment bookings, lead status updates, price changes — back to it.

Can the agent handle customer communications for trade-in valuations and financing inquiries?+

Yes. The agent can collect vehicle information via a chat or form interface, pass it to a valuation API, and return a range estimate to the customer — qualifying their interest before a finance manager's time is involved. Financing pre-qualification inquiries are handled similarly, with the agent collecting information and surfacing it to the F&I team when the customer is ready.

How does the agent improve parts inventory management for service operations?+

The agent analyzes historical RO data, current open appointments, and supplier lead times to identify parts that should be stocked or expedited. It generates purchase orders for pre-approved parts categories and alerts the parts manager when a required part is unavailable, reducing appointment delays caused by parts shortages.

Traditional Approach vs AI Agents For Automotive

See exactly where AI agents outperform manual processes in measurable, business-critical ways.

TraditionalWith AI AgentsAdvantage

BDC representatives manually respond to internet leads during business hours, with average response times of 2–6 hours and no coverage overnight or on weekends.

The agent monitors all lead inbound channels 24/7, responds within seconds with personalized vehicle-specific information, and books appointments directly into the sales calendar.

Higher lead-to-appointment conversion rates, especially for customers who submit inquiries outside business hours and are currently lost to faster-responding competitors.

Used vehicle pricing is updated weekly or monthly based on manager review of market reports, leaving inventory over- or under-priced for days relative to current market conditions.

The agent monitors live market comparable data daily, surfacing specific repricing recommendations for aged or competitively priced inventory based on days-on-lot and regional demand.

Fresher pricing increases turn rate on aged units and prevents underpricing on high-demand vehicles — directly improving gross profit per unit and days supply.

Service advisors manually check technician availability, estimate job duration from memory, and schedule appointments that often run over or create scheduling conflicts.

The agent uses historical job duration data by make, model, and repair type to schedule appointments with accurate time blocks, balancing load across available technicians automatically.

Better scheduling accuracy reduces customer wait times, improves technician utilization, and increases the number of ROs completed per day without additional staffing.
